** The flooring installers market in Lake Pleasant and the surrounding Adirondack region is characterized by a small number of highly specialized, service-area contractors rather than a dense, competitive urban market. Due to the rural nature and seasonal "camp" or second-home population, the most successful contractors are those with extensive reach, often operating from hubs in nearby towns like Speculator, Northville, or Long Lake. **Average Quality:** The quality is generally high, as contractors rely heavily on word-of-mouth and long-term community reputation. The challenging climate demands expertise in dealing with subfloor moisture and temperature fluctuations. **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ate but localized. There are few "big box" store installers, so independent contractors dominate. Their schedules can book up quickly, especially during the summer and early fall.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is typically at a premium compared to urban areas due to travel time, the cost of material logistics, and the specialized nature of the work. Lake Pleasant experiences a humid continental climate with cold, snowy winters and warm, humid summers. This significant seasonal moisture and temperature fluctuation makes dimensional stability crucial. We highly recommend engineered hardwood, luxury vinyl plank (LVP), or tile over solid hardwood, which can expand and contract excessively, leading to gaps or buckling in our local environment.
For a standard room, professional installation typically takes 1-3 days, but project scheduling in Hamilton County is highly seasonal. Summer and early fall are peak times, so book consultations 4-8 weeks in advance. In winter, accessibility due to snow and the need for proper material acclimation indoors (often 48-72 hours) can add time, so planning ahead is essential.
While most basic flooring replacements don't require a town permit, any project involving structural changes to subfloors or electrical work (like installing radiant heat under floors) likely will. For homes near the lake or in specific watershed areas, there may be additional environmental guidelines for disposal. Always check with the Lake Pleasant Town Code Office before starting, and a reputable local installer will handle this.
Prioritize local, licensed, and insured contractors with verifiable references from other Adirondack homes. They should understand regional challenges like dealing with older camp foundations, seasonal humidity, and ensuring a tight seal against drafts. Check for membership in organizations like the NYS Flooring Association and always review their portfolio for projects similar to yours.
Acclimation allows flooring materials to adjust to the specific humidity and temperature of your home, preventing major issues after installation. Given our climate, boxes of flooring must be brought inside and left in the center of the room where they will be installed for a minimum of 48-72 hours. A professional installer will check moisture levels in both the subfloor and planks to ensure they are within manufacturer specifications before beginning.
